The investigation, launched in May 2012, prompted two US Senate hearings, and the US Environmental Protection Agency announced it would launch an investigation of flame retardants. Also, California’s governor said the state would scrap the rule responsible for flame retardants’ presence in furniture.","brand":"Agate Digital","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":47184475980016,"sku":"9781572844216","price":2.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0737\/7593\/9824\/files\/9781572844216_p0.jpg?v=1763792695","url":"https:\/\/shop-qa.barnesandnoble.com\/products\/9781572844216","provider":"Barnes \u0026 Noble (DEV)","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
